How to change the time format for meetings

Set your meeting times to 12-hour or 24-hour format. Your choice applies across your calendar, meeting icons, and email summaries.

This article shows you how to change the time format HappyScribe uses for your meetings, whether you prefer 12-hour (1:00 PM) or 24-hour (13:00). You can set it once and every meeting time you see will follow your choice.


Change your time format

  1. Click Settings in the lower-left corner of your dashboard.

  2. On the Account tab, find the Time format dropdown.

  3. Pick one of the three options:

    • Automatic (based on your region): uses 24-hour format unless your country typically uses 12-hour. This is the default for new accounts.

    • 12-hour (1:00 PM): shows times with AM/PM.

    • 24-hour (13:00): shows times without AM/PM.

  4. Click Save account information at the bottom of the form.

Where the time format appears

Your time format choice applies across all meeting views:

  • Your meetings calendar and calendar event rows

  • Meeting date and time icons in lists and details

  • Meeting summary emails you receive after a meeting

The setting is per user, so each team member can choose their own preference without affecting anyone else.


How Automatic detection works

When set to Automatic, HappyScribe uses your country to decide the format. Most countries use 24-hour time by default. If your country is one of those that typically uses a 12-hour clock, such as the United States, Canada, Australia, India, or the Philippines, you will see 12-hour times.

If you travel or want to override this, switch to your preferred format manually and your choice will be saved.
